Sun Communities and UnitedHealth Group: 2 Undervalued Stocks That Raised Dividends in June

Sun Communities, a real estate investment trust (REIT), increased its quarterly dividend on June 30, 2025, to $1.04 per share, representing a $4.16 annualized dividend and a 3.22% yield. The company's dividend payout ratio is currently 670.97%, indicating a high payout relative to its earnings [2]. Sun Communities operates a portfolio of 667 developed manufactured housing, RV, and marina properties in the U.S., the UK, and Canada, with a market capitalization of $16.50 billion as of July 2, 2025 [1].
UnitedHealth Group, a healthcare services company, also raised its dividend in June 2025. The company's dividend payout ratio is around 30% of its profits, with analysts expecting a healthy payout ratio to continue [2]. UnitedHealth has a narrow economic moat, with a fair value estimate of $473.00 and a high fair value uncertainty [2]. The company's strong financial performance and stable dividend history make it an attractive investment option for income-focused investors.
Both Sun Communities and UnitedHealth Group offer investors the potential to benefit from increased dividend yields and the possibility of their investment values growing.
